Recognizing the Concern
The initial step in attending to a blocked drainpipe is identifying the indications. Sluggish water drainage, gurgling noises, foul odors emanating from drains, or water backing up prevail signs of an obstructed drain. Determining these indicators early can help protect against additionally issues.
Common Sources Of Blocked Drainpipes
Recognizing the variables that contribute to drain clogs is vital for efficient resolution. Usual offenders consist of hair, soap residue, oil, food debris, and international things like hygienic products or paper towels. Tree origins attacking underground pipes can likewise trigger substantial blockages.

Safety nets
To avoid future clogs, embracing safety nets is critical. Set up drainpipe guards or strainers to capture hair and debris before they get in the pipes. Regularly flush drains with warm water to liquify grease accumulation, and stay clear of getting rid of oil or solid waste away.
When to Call a Specialist
While DIY services can solve minor clogs, particular indicators show the requirement for specialist support. Consistent obstructions, foul odors in spite of cleansing efforts, or several drains pipes supporting simultaneously are red flags that warrant skilled intervention.

Safety Precautions
When trying do it yourself drain cleaning, focus on safety and security. Wear safety handwear covers and glasses to prevent contact with unsafe chemicals or microorganisms. Never mix various drainpipe cleaning items, as this can produce harmful fumes.

How Do Plumbers And Drainage Experts Clear Blocked Drains?
To better understand exactly where the problem is located, experts will typically start with an assessment and a video sewer inspection. Using non-invasive equipment that enters and exits through the pipe, these cameras offer a look inside the pipe and can spot anything from buildup, to forming clogs, to tree roots to small holes that could be a future problem – in real-time. It can see up to 150 feet of even the hard-to-reach places of the line, so there’s nowhere to hide.
